Latest News – 20-02-2017

Club Membership: Money for club registration is now due from all players and anyone else who wishes to become a member of Fr. Manning Gaels for 2017. Membership is €30 for adults and €15 for students. Players who do not pay their membership fee will not be covered by club insurance should injury arise. Only those who have paid membership will be eligible to represent the club in the upcoming season. Membership entitles entry in the draw for All-Ireland football and hurling tickets in August. Those who pay membership by March 31st will also be eligible to vote at next year’s AGM. Membership to be paid to Bridie Reilly, Club Registrar (0863332863) or any member of the executive as soon as possible.

Senior Challenge: The seniors had their first workout of the year on Sunday morning in Monaduff against Redhills of Cavan. The Gaels won out in the end on a score line of 3-8 to 1-11. The team and scorers were as follows: David Collum, Daniel Gorman, Cian Brady, Aaron McGee, Stephen Cosgrave, Mark Hughes, Nigel Kiernan, Anthony Kane, Eoin Keane (1-2), Tom McGee, Dean Cosgrave (1-1), Kevin Whitney, Petie Collum (0-2), Martin Cassidy, Pauric Gill (0-3).

Substitutions: Diarmuid Cooney (1-0), Darren Smith, Ryan McGee.

Thank you to Redhills for coming down and providing the challenge. We wish them the best of luck for the coming year. Thanks also to Lorraine Corrigan for the refreshments afterwards. Training continues as normal this week.

Latest News – 06-02-2017

Annual Club Social: The Fr. Manning Gaels and St. Helen’s Annual Social was held last Saturday in the Olde Village Inn, Drumlish. A great night was had by all and we would like to thank MC Brendan Corrigan, Frank Feery for the excellent entertainment, Tom Cassidy and staff for their hospitality and Dial a Chef who provided the meals. On the night the senior team collected their Division 2 and Patsy Reilly Cup medals; David Collum received the Eamon Kerrigan Perpetual Trophy for senior player of the year; Dean Cosgrave received the Jimmy Tully Memorial Trophy for U21 player of the year and Lorraine Corrigan received the John Joe Brady Memorial Trophy for Club Person of the year. Mark Hughes received the St. Vincent’s minor player of the year and a special award was given to Eamon Hughes for his many years of hard work for the minor club. St. Helen’s made a special presentation to Sinéad Corrigan, Sinéad Hughes, Laura Burke and Orla Noonan as a result of winning the All Ireland Junior championship with Longford in 2016. Leah Donnelly received senior player of the year; Aoife Donnelly received underage player of the year and Amanda O’Hara received the most improved player award. Well done to all concerned. A special word of thanks to Longford County Board Chairperson Eamon Reilly and Vice Chairperson Bríd McGoldrick for making the presentations, it was greatly appreciated.
